The after-awards-ceremony parties were many and three of those honoured shared the spotlight at one of them on Heroes' Day, Monday, October 20.

Ambassador Stan McLelland, Sydney Engel and Judge Pamela Appelt were hosted by The Gleaner's Oliver Clarke and his wife, Monica Ladd, on Monday evening.

The jovial McLelland, who is a former United States ambassador, had helped Jamaica to restart the export of canned ackee to the United States. The fruit was given a bad rap because of its toxic properties, but Ambassador McLelland helped pave the way for much-needed foreign exchange and recognition.

Engel started the MoBay Hope clinic and continues to support it. Both men received honorary Orders of Distinction (OD). Dr Appelt, a native of St Mary, received the OD (Officer Class) for dedicated service to Jamaica and the diaspora in Canada. Even before joining the diaspora committee she was always involved in the development of the land of her birth. She also works with the Early Childhood Foundation.
